Aztreonam IV

Permitted Indications

May be used for the following indications:

  1. As an alternative to gentamicin for patients with CrCl < 30mL/min (CKD≥4) or known or suspected Acute Kidney Injury (AKI) in previous 48 hours (≥50% increase in baseline serum creatinine or oliguria > 6 hours) being treated empirically for sepsis of unknown origin.
  2. As an alternative to gentamicin for high risk patients with CrCl < 30mL/min (CKD≥4) or known or suspected AKI in previous 48 hours (≥50% increase in baseline serum creatinine or oliguria > 6 hours) being treated empirically for neutropenic sepsis.
  3. On the advice of a Medical Microbiologist or Infection Specialist for treatment of gram-negative infections.
